What to Know About Raptor Documentation When You're Out and About in Texas

When in possession of a raptor outside of your permitted facility, make sure you have all necessary permits and documentation at hand. This is key to staying compliant with regulations, ensuring the welfare of your bird, and avoiding misunderstandings with wildlife officials.

What’s Included in Your Raptor Permits?

Now, if you’re wondering what specific permits and documentation you need, you're not alone. Here’s a short rundown:

  • Training Certifications: Proof that your raptor has been trained properly—this is vital for both you and your bird’s safety.

  • Species Identification: A document confirming the species of your raptor, because not all birds of prey are created equal!

  • Federal and State Compliance Forms: Yes, there are forms! And they’re there for a reason.
